Pecan Sour Cream Coffee Cake

  Cake
1  c      sugar

1/2 c   butter
3          eggs
2  c      flour
1  t       baking powder
1  t       baking soda
1/4  t    salt
1  c       sour cream
1/2 c    raisins

          Mix flour, powder, soda and salt and set aside.       Preheat oven to 350.
          Cream butter and sugar with a mixer.
          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each one.
           Add flour, soda, powder and salt alternately with sour cream.
            Sprinkle raisins over the top and stir in.

               Pecan Topping
    3/4 c   brown sugar, packed
    2  t       butter
    1  T       flour
    1  t       cinnamon
    1  c       pecans, chopped  

    Combine butter, sugar, cinnamon and flour and mix until completely mixed.
     Stir in chopped nuts.
         set aside.

        Spread 1/2 of the cake mixture in a greased 9 x 13 pan. Sprinkle with 1/2 of the pecan topping.
         Add the remaining cake dough  and sprinkle with the rest of the topping mixture.

                  Bake at 350 for about 30 minutes or until done.
       (Mom would stick a broom straw into it to see if the straw came out clean)
